E0605: r##"
|
||||||
|
An invalid cast was attempted.
|
||||||
|
|
||||||
|
Erroneous code examples:
|
||||||
|
|
||||||
|
```compile_fail,E0605
|
||||||
|
let x = 0u8;
|
||||||
|
x as Vec<u8>; // error: non-scalar cast: `u8` as `std::vec::Vec<u8>`
|
||||||
|
|
||||||
|
// Another example
|
||||||
|
|
||||||
|
let v = 0 as *const u8; // So here, `v` is a `*const u8`.
|
||||||
|
v as &u8; // error: non-scalar cast: `*const u8` as `&u8`
|
||||||
|
```
|
||||||
|
|
||||||
|
Only primitive types cast be casted into each others. Examples:
|
||||||
|
|
||||||
|
```
|
||||||
|
let x = 0u8;
|
||||||
|
x as u32; // ok!
|
||||||
|
|
||||||
|
let v = 0 as *const u8;
|
||||||
|
v as *const i8; // ok!
|
||||||
|
```
|
||||||
|
"##,
